Transaction 711bbf838e6c6d25a51f5614a0301227d75041537f8048e9fba78916ccfc314a
1 Input
2 Outputs
- 711bbf838e6c6d25a51f5614a0301227d75041537f8048e9fba78916ccfc314a:0
- 711bbf838e6c6d25a51f5614a0301227d75041537f8048e9fba78916ccfc314a:1
value 618
address 1KLBGHJJ9ayn5VHuNzAwiHE7Ngr8ZQqNVs
value 954961
address 1KmLuWRmPfpWYKZePfLtXCMiRe5q8HmGK9